Having problems with my 1651b fluke mft when measuring my ze when i clip the croc clip on earth and touch probes on phase and neutral it shows error 4 straight away without me pressing test. I've tried this at home too on my board same thing is it time for a new tester or leads. every other test fine so makes me think the leads are fine.
 
Don't have the manual in front of me , but when measuring Zs and putting leads on phase and neutral display shows Error 4 until I put the earth lead on. If I stil get Error 4 then I start suspecting there is no earth!

If its your leads I would expect the zero'ing values to be changing. If you've had the tester a longeish time you should know roundabout what they usually are.
